First of all, we DO NOT say 'Dang seen' to friends. Second of all, I'd like you to think of a, i, e, o as romanized Japanese when you see my romanization. And I also romanize ㅓ as u/uh (u of run), ㅜ as oo(oo of soon). Lastly I'm not exactly sure what you meant by it, but you will find out after seeing this.
Nice to meet you = Man na suh bang gap seumnida [Formal]
= Man na suh bang ga wuh yo [Informal]
= Man na suh bang ga wuh [Between close friends]
People say this when they first meet someone.
Nice meeting you = Man na suh bang ga wut sseum nida [Formal]
Man na suh bang ga wut ssuh yo [Informal]
Man na suh bang ga wut ssuh [Between close friends]
It's what people say when they're leaving.
